Oracle FAQ Your Portal to the Oracle Knowledge Grid
H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US
 

Home -> Community -> Usenet -> c.d.o.server -> Re: USER pseudocolumn

Re: USER pseudocolumn

From: Michel Cadot <micadot{at}altern{dot}org>
Date: Wed, 15 Mar 2006 18:22:00 +0100
Message-ID: <44184d3c$0$27046$626a54ce@news.free.fr>

"EdStevens" <quetico_man_at_yahoo.com> a écrit dans le message de news: 1142442445.905578.304150_at_i39g2000cwa.googlegroups.com...
| Oracle 9.2
|
| I've been digging thru tahiti and the ng archives for the last two
| hours, and can't find what I'm looking for.
|
| Trying to set up a logon trigger to start extended tracing ... code is:
|
| create or replace trigger logon_trigger
| after logon on database
| begin
| if (user = 'UC7001' ) then
| execute immediate
| 'ALTER SESSION SET TRACEFILE_IDENTIFIER=''UC7001''';
| execute immediate
| 'ALTER SESSION SET EVENTS ''10046 TRACE NAME CONTEXT FOREVER,
| LEVEL 12''';
| end if;
| end;
|
| Only, instead of referincing the user in the 'if' statement, we want to
| trigger by OS userid. Problem is, I can't find a comprehensive list of
| pseudo columns. Searching tahiti for 'pseudocolumn' obviously yeilds
| several hits, most of which are just passing references. The one place
| that looks like a full list is in the SQL Reference manual, but it only
| lists CURRVAL, NEXTVAL, ROWID, ROWNUM, and XMLDATA. Of course, if I
| search on USER, I get a zillion hits ....
|
| Can someone get me back on track?
|
| Thanks.
|

SYS_CONTEXT('USERENV','OS_USER') Regards
Michel Cadot Received on Wed Mar 15 2006 - 11:22:00 CST

Original text of this message

HOME | ASK QUESTION | ADD INFO | SEARCH | E-MAIL US